EPM7128STC100-6F Description
The EPM7128STC100-6F is a Complex Programmable Logic Device (CPLD) from Intel's MAX® 7000S series, designed for a wide range of embedded applications. This IC is characterized by its 128 macrocells, 84 I/O pins, and a programmable type that supports in-system programming, making it highly versatile and adaptable for various electronic designs. The device operates within a supply voltage range of 4.75V to 5.25V and an operating temperature range of 0°C to 70°C (TA), ensuring reliable performance in standard industrial environments. With a maximum propagation delay of 6 ns, it offers high-speed operation, which is critical for time-sensitive applications.
EPM7128STC100-6F Features
- High Macrocell Count: The 128 macrocells provide ample logic resources, enabling the implementation of complex logic functions within a single chip.
- In-System Programmability: This feature allows for programming and reprogramming of the device while it is installed in the system, facilitating easy updates and modifications without the need for physical rework.
- Surface Mount Technology: The surface mount package ensures compatibility with modern PCB assembly processes, contributing to compact and reliable designs.
- Wide Operating Voltage Range: The 4.75V to 5.25V supply voltage range ensures compatibility with a variety of power supply configurations, enhancing the device's versatility.
- High-Speed Performance: With a maximum propagation delay of 6 ns, the EPM7128STC100-6F is well-suited for applications requiring fast signal processing and control.
- Comprehensive I/O Capability: The 84 I/O pins offer extensive connectivity options, allowing for integration with multiple peripherals and subsystems.
- Moisture Sensitivity Level 3: The MSL 3 rating (168 hours) ensures the device's reliability in environments with varying humidity levels, making it suitable for a broad range of industrial applications.
EPM7128STC100-6F Applications
The EPM7128STC100-6F is ideal for applications that require high-density logic and fast processing capabilities. Some specific use cases include:
- Industrial Control Systems: The device's robustness and high macrocell count make it suitable for controlling complex machinery and processes, where multiple inputs and outputs need to be managed efficiently.
- Telecommunications: In telecom equipment, the CPLD can be used for signal processing, protocol conversion, and interfacing with various communication standards.
- Consumer Electronics: The EPM7128STC100-6F can be employed in consumer devices for tasks such as display control, sensor interfacing, and microcontroller augmentation.
- Automotive Electronics: The device's ability to handle multiple I/O operations and its in-system programmability make it a good fit for automotive applications, such as engine control units and advanced driver-assistance systems (ADAS).
Conclusion of EPM7128STC100-6F
The EPM7128STC100-6F from Intel's MAX® 7000S series is a versatile and high-performance CPLD that offers significant advantages over similar models. Its combination of a high macrocell count, in-system programmability, and a wide operating voltage range makes it an excellent choice for a variety of embedded applications. Despite being marked as obsolete, the EPM7128STC100-6F remains a reliable and efficient solution for designers seeking a robust CPLD with extensive I/O capabilities and fast processing speeds.